The Power of Focused Work

This chapter examines the effective work habits of historical figures who engaged in intense creative sessions of three to four hours. It underscores the benefits of focused productivity over continuous busyness, emphasizing the importance of time management. By encouraging readers to prioritize meaningful tasks and embrace the limits of time, the discussion highlights that less can lead to more in terms of creative output.
